This fascinating vintage Faradobeh carpet hails from the Bakhtiar region of Iran, a weaving centre celebrated for producing robust and beautiful rugs using high-quality handspun wool and natural vegetable dyes. This piece stands out as both decorative and rare, making it an excellent addition for collectors or interior designers seeking uniqueness.
What makes this carpet especially noteworthy is its rare all-over motif, an unusual layout within the Faradobeh weaving tradition, which typically features central medallion or garden designs. The rich red ground provides a warm, dramatic backdrop for the intricate patterning, bringing vibrancy and presence to any room.
Framing the bold field is a light beige border, delicately filled with stylised floral motifs, offering a soft contrast that enhances the overall design without overwhelming it. The balance of colour and form creates a harmonious aesthetic, while the traditional elements maintain the cultural integrity of the piece.
This vintage Bakhtiar carpet is not only decorative but also durable and versatile, suitable for both classic and eclectic interiors.
